Wagering, game contribution and cashout limits

The journey from free spins to real money involves some rules that can make or break the value of any no deposit spins prize. The wagering requirement tells you how many times you must ‘play through’ your winnings before withdrawing. Additionally, only certain games count fully towards fulfilling these wagering conditions.

For example, slots often contribute 100% to wagering, but live table games or video poker may contribute 0% or very little, meaning they won’t help clear your bonus faster. The maximum cashout cap means even if you win big, there’s a ceiling on what you can withdraw, keeping the casino’s risk manageable.

Bonus element Typical rule Player impact
Wagering requirement 20x to 50x winnings Determines how much playthrough is needed before cashout.
Game contribution Slots 100%, Table games 0-10% Choosing the right games speeds bonus clearance.
Maximum cashout limit $100 to $500 NZD Caps winnings you can withdraw from free spins.
Minimum stake for wager equity $1 to $5 NZD bets Ensures fair play and prevents bonus abuse.

Common pitfalls and limitations to watch for

It might feel like you’ve struck gold seeing an offer for 25 free spins no deposit, but it pays to approach these deals with a dose of reality. Common restrictions can seriously reduce the value of such freebies, turning what looked like a great chance into a frustrating dead-end.

One of the most frequent annoyances is the maximum cashout limit attached to winnings derived from free spins. For example, even if your spins hit a solid jackpot or multiple big wins, the site might cap your withdrawal at a low figure like $50 or $100. This means the site keeps anything above that limit, a massive killjoy for players hoping to build real bankroll boosts.

Wagering requirements are another hurdle. This is the total amount you need to bet before cashing out any winnings from free spins. High wagering can strip away the value quickly — imagine needing to wager 40x or 50x your bonus plus winnings to convert the spins into withdrawable cash. That’s a big ask unless you’re comfortable playing long sessions risking your own money to meet those targets.

Additionally, watch out for:

  • Exclusion of popular or high RTP games from the spins, limiting your chance of success.
  • Contribution caps where winnings from certain games count only partially towards wagering.
  • Expiry dates that demand you use the spins or bonus within a few days or weeks or lose them entirely.
  • Inactivity clauses that revoke bonus balances or spins if you don’t meet playthrough conditions quickly.

Imagine claiming free spins for a slick video slot only to realise half the spins aren’t valid on that title. Or hitting a $75 win but seeing your withdrawal truncated to $25 because of a cap. These are red flags players face regularly. A quick read through the “bonus terms and conditions” section helps avoid nasty surprises.
